A dental provider who understands pediatric dental care knows that children have different needs than adults. Baby teeth require special attention because they help with chewing, speech development, and guiding permanent teeth into place. Regular dental visits help monitor growth, spot concerns early, and provide guidance on daily oral hygiene. When care is tailored to a child’s age and comfort level, appointments often feel less stressful and more familiar over time.
Another important factor is communication. A dental team that explains procedures in simple terms can help reduce fear and build trust. This approach encourages children to ask questions and feel more comfortable during visits. Over time, this can support consistent dental check-ups and better cooperation during treatments such as cleanings or cavity prevention.
Preventive care is also a key part of maintaining children’s oral health. Services like routine exams, cleanings, fluoride treatments, and sealants can help reduce the risk of tooth decay. Guidance on brushing techniques, flossing, and nutrition gives parents tools to support healthy habits at home. These small steps can contribute to long-term dental wellness.
